In today's episode, we speak with Neil Theise, a pathologist at NYU and author of Notes on Complexity: A Scientific Theory of Connection, Consciousness and Being. Expect to learn about complexity theory and its implications for sentience, how great ideas are formed, whether AGI can be built with silicon-based computers, and much more!
